1) Janet’s Treasure Chest

When I visited Janet’s Treasure Chest, I found a wide variety of gifts suited for many occasions. The shop carries an impressive selection, making it easy to find something for family or friends without spending too much.
The store has a relaxed atmosphere, perfect for browsing. I noticed the staff were helpful but reminded me they begin closing up 15 minutes before the listed closing time, which is helpful to know if you plan a late visit.
Janet’s Treasure Chest is open every day from 9 AM to 5 PM. It’s located right off Hwy 259 N in Hochatown, which makes it easy to stop by while exploring Broken Bow.

3) Hochatime

When I stepped into Hochatime, I noticed a well-organized space with a variety of gift items. The shop includes not only souvenirs but also clothing that captures the local vibe. It’s clear they focus on quality and unique pieces.
The staff was friendly and willing to help me find the perfect keepsake. I appreciated the selection of items that reflect the spirit of Hochatown and the surrounding area. The store also has a location called Hochatime Hideaway nearby, which offers a slightly different range of products.
The atmosphere is relaxed, making it a good stop for anyone passing through or looking for a present. Whether you want a small souvenir or a special gift, Hochatime delivers a solid shopping experience.

4) Cabin Daddy Backwoods Emporium

When I visited Cabin Daddy Backwoods Emporium, I was immediately drawn to its rustic charm and inviting atmosphere. The store offers a wide variety of items, including unique gifts, rustic apparel, and souvenirs that capture the spirit of the Backwoods. It’s more than just a gift shop; it feels like a small adventure through the local culture.
I enjoyed browsing the collection of exclusive t-shirts and apparel for men, women, and kids. The designs have a distinct Backwoods vibe, perfect for anyone wanting a genuine souvenir or item that reflects the Hochatown area. The store also has an interesting selection of toys and pet items, which adds to the diverse shopping experience.
What stood out to me were the photo opportunities around the emporium. You can snap pictures by the Cabin Daddy Wing wall or pose with the Bear Family statues. It’s a nice touch that makes the visit memorable beyond just shopping. Overall, the store felt welcoming and well-curated for both visitors and locals.

What Makes Hochatown Gift Shops Unique?
Hochatown’s gift shops stand out because they offer a blend of handcrafted local products, carefully chosen regional items, and a welcoming shopping environment. These elements come together to create a distinctive experience that reflects the area’s culture and natural beauty.
Local Artistry
Many gift shops in Hochatown feature handcrafted items made by local artisans. These pieces include paintings, pottery, and woodwork that showcase the talents and traditions of the community. For example, shops like Gallery 259 present striking artwork curated from regional artists, giving visitors access to authentic, one-of-a-kind items you won’t find elsewhere.
This support of local creators helps maintain the area’s artistic heritage. It also offers shoppers meaningful souvenirs that carry the story of Hochatown, rather than mass-produced products. When I visit, I appreciate the opportunity to connect with the creators behind the products.
Curated Regional Products
Hochatown’s gift shops often stock items that reflect the surrounding region’s lifestyle and natural environment. You’ll find cabin décor, outdoor gear, local food specialties, and vintage finds. Shops such as Hochatown Mountain Co. are known for carefully selecting products that appeal to both locals and tourists seeking authentic regional items.
This curation ensures quality and relevance, making the shopping experience feel focused and personalized. When browsing these stores, I notice a thoughtful attention to what truly represents this part of Oklahoma, from rustic home accents to unique souvenirs.
